Firstly! The curly ponytail. Sorry I took this one today to round it up to four hairstyles and went college like this today. 

I had curly hair today but then it went really windy. It was crazy wind and my hair was just going everywhere. Therefore I put my hair up in a ponytail and I quite liked it. The curly hair makes it perfect for windy and fog weather as the curls loosed through the day, it looked like you styled it that way however when you have straight hair, your hair always seems to go wavy/curly.

Then there is the fish tail braid. I just look this look, specially as you don't need any hot tools unless you need to sort your fringe out or the little bits round the side.

If your hair got more then one colours, natural hair has different tones along with if you have ombred or got highlights, it looks nice as you are able to see the different tones. This is quick and simple plus it's a little different. This is really good if you want your hair out of your way without putting it up completely.

Thirdly, there is the half up, half down look. This is my favourite way to have my hair. Specially for wavy/curly hair, it's the best way to keep most of my hair away from my face but yet keeping down. 

If you got thick hair like me, you will know that bobby pins really do nothing at all in your hair. You need to get these little clips, they are amazing to keeping hold on your hair plus you can get them in different colours. They also help to give your hair a little volume, they are a must need for me!

Finally, the last hairstyle is just the classic doughnut style bun. This is good for rainy days, all your hair is tucked away neatly or tidy, up to you.

As you can see, i have a little ginger bun but this is a good way to give your casual look a smart look. I do this a few times if I'm going out, give it's a smarter and sleek look to your outfit. It looks like you have made more off an effort while you are still wearing your smart/casual outfit.
